ABSTRACT:
A lenticular, rigid, optionally hollow, molded plastic part wet-resistant toward aqueous media, for example acryl glass, is proposed as an implantable temporary filler for a mammary gland prosthesis that can be implanted in surgery following amputation of the mammary gland until after the healing of the site of the operation. The molded part has an oval horizontal projection and is bounded by two curved surfaces, one of them a concave and an approximately cylindrical surface whose curvature is adapted to the human thorax in the area of the breast and the other an approximately spherical surface whose radius is smaller than the radius of curvature of the cylindrical surface.
